A historic railway wants to build a new booking station and souvenir shop.
Groudle Glen Railway in Onchan has asked for planning permission to build the new facility at its Lhen Coan station.
In its application, the railway says the new building would be carefully designed to fit in with the current architectural style.
The upgrade would give passengers an indoor waiting area as well as improve the line's operation.
